Nike.com has Nike Men's ZoomX SuperRep Surge Shoes (Black/Martian Sunrise/Sea Glass/Black) on sale for $43.48 after 25% off discount at checkout (add to bag for price). Shipping is free w/ Nike Account (free to join).

Thanks to Deal Hunter daisybeetle for finding this deal.

Available colors (prices after 25% discount at checkout):About this product:
  • The Nike ZoomX SuperRep Surge is built for classes and workouts that keep you moving. From the treadmill to the rowing machine to strength training, you get the responsive cushioning of Nike ZoomX foam and containment support from an arc on the side to keep you ahead of the curve.

Couple of thoughts.

Activity:

I do not have these but was tempted to get a pair for my wife a few weeks ago. From what I read they seem to be what she would use them for which is dancing, hiit, agility movements in place. Those who have these can chime in but I would only use these for cross-training, aerobic in place type activity (like beachbody?). I am more of a runner/gym person than my wife.

Fit:

I recently bought the zoom pegasus, zoom pegasus trail, react miler, metcon, air max 2090. There are always comments on narrowness of nikes and for good reason. Every pair feels different to me. In general, I find the more geared toward style the more narrow. The more geared toward running, the wider the shoe. I have semi-wide feet and from most narrow to wide is air max 2090, react miler (surprisingly more narrow to me than metcon), metcon, zoom pegasus, zoom pegasus trail. Of course this could also be due to the more airy flexible material in running shoes that make them less tight. For other brand reference, I also have the Adidas zk 2x boost which are wider than all my nikes and more comfortable by a country mile for errands/walking. They'd be too sloppy/squishy for running for my taste.

Sorry for the wordiness, I just had to buy multiple shoes after I gained weight during pandemic. My go to runners were the lower profile frees (flyknits) but extra support in the soles of other nikes feel better with the extra weight in my knees.

With the help of others who actually have the zoom x, I hope people don't have to go through as many shoes as I did to find the right pair for the right activity.
